    When I walked in the door I had an LG Transpyre prepaid phone with one gig of high-speed data unlimited talk and unlimited text. That was $53.50 a month including taxes. I was paying $20 per extra 3 GB of data as I needed it. I was doing that about 3-4 times a month. So I was actually paying about $115-$135 a month to browse the web on my tiny phone.

    So here is what I'm paying now:

    Please note I'm only supplying exact bill details so people who are interested in the future can know what to expect if you want to upgrade or come over to Verizon. I think this is a "good cellular plan for truck drivers":

    New iPad Pro monthly charges:
    -Line access: $10
    -Insurance: $9
    -Monthly payment to purchase device: $45.22

    Smart phone monthly charges:
    -Line access: $20
    (I kept my prepaid phone, so I don't have to pay for anything else since I own this device already)

    16 GB LTE data with unlimited talk & text:
    -$90 ($82.80 with Magnum 8% employee discount)

    Total monthly payment: $167.02 (actually $171.40 after admin, 911 access, and other small fees)

    I ended up paying $255.58 in store, for an awesome Otterbox case with a screen protector and a pair of extra long charging cables. One for the standard 120v outlet and one car charger. I know there were some fees and taxes in there too but unfortunately I don't have my receipt for the breakdown on that. My prepaid balance transferred over as well, so that applied to my first bill.

    First bill will be +$20 for line activation fee ($191.40).

    Is it worth it? So far, yes! I get the bigger screen I wanted along with a faster LTE connection than the 3G I have on my prepaid phone. I kept my same phone and I don't have to buy a laptop now. I don't pay for internet back home because I room with my brother and I don't pay for half of the internet bill while I'm not there. So I'm only paying for Internet (data) once. So far I haven't stopped anywhere that my iPad hasn't had full LTE service. I'm very happy with what I have now.
